【手把手教你制作智能小车】在当今科技飞速发展的时代,智能小车作为一种集机械、电子与编程于一体的项目,越来越受到爱好者和初学者的关注。本文将从基础概念出发,逐步讲解如何亲手制作一台简单的智能小车,帮助你掌握相关知识并实现动手实践。
一、项目概述
智能小车通常是指具备一定自主控制能力的小型车辆,可以通过传感器感知环境,并根据预设程序进行移动或避障等操作。本项目适合电子、机器人、编程等领域的初学者,能够帮助理解硬件连接、传感器使用以及基本的编程逻辑。
二、所需材料清单
序号 | 材料名称 | 数量 | 说明 |
1 | 微控制器(如Arduino) | 1个 | 控制核心 |
2 | 电机驱动模块 | 1个 | 控制电机运行 |
3 | 直流电机 | 2个 | 驱动小车前进后退 |
4 | 轮子与底盘 | 1套 | 提供移动基础 |
5 | 超声波传感器 | 1个 | 检测障碍物距离 |
6 | 电源模块(电池) | 1组 | 为系统供电 |
7 | 连接线若干 | - | 用于电路连接 |
8 | 电脑(用于编程) | 1台 | 编写与上传代码 |
三、制作步骤概要
1. 组装底盘:将电机固定在底盘上,安装轮子,确保结构稳固。
2. 连接电路:按照电路图将微控制器、电机驱动模块、超声波传感器等连接起来。
3. 编写程序:使用Arduino IDE编写代码,实现小车的前进、后退、转向及避障功能。
4. 测试运行:上传程序后,对小车进行实际测试,调整参数以优化性能。
5. 调试与改进:根据测试结果,对传感器灵敏度、电机速度等进行微调。
四、关键知识点总结
知识点 | 内容简述 |
微控制器 | 控制整个系统的“大脑”,负责执行程序指令 |
电机驱动 | 将控制信号转换为电机动作,保护主控芯片 |
传感器应用 | 实现环境感知,是智能小车“眼睛”的关键 |
编程逻辑 | 包括条件判断、循环控制等,决定小车行为 |
电源管理 | 合理选择电池类型与电压,保障系统稳定运行 |
五、注意事项
- 在焊接或连接电路时,注意安全,避免短路或损坏元件。
- 初次编程时,建议参考官方教程或社区资源,减少错误率。
- 测试过程中,保持耐心,逐步调试,不要急于求成。
通过以上步骤,你可以一步步完成自己的智能小车制作。这个过程不仅锻炼了动手能力,还加深了对电子与编程的理解。希望你能从中获得乐趣,并不断探索更多可能性!